• Journal: Journal of Language Teaching and Research
• Authors: Hanna Onyi Yusuf and Agnes Ovayioza Enesi
• Year: 2012

In the article “Using Sound in Teaching Reading in Early Childhood Education,”


Yusuf and Enesi discuss how childhood education is a crucial time in teaching literacy.
This stage in life can effect positively or negatively impact their future and success.
Therefore, teaching children how to read and write is extremely important because their
literacy levels with impact everything they do. The authors of this article point out that
the best way to teach literacy using phonics. Phonics includes more spoken language,
playing and singing. In this way, children will be taught that literacy is fun. If children
have this mindset, they will be more successful, especially since literacy is central in
everything humans do.

• Name: “Pre-teachers’ Beliefs About Young Children, Their Parents, and Teaching
Early Childhood Education”
• Author: Jale Aldemir
• Year: 2007

In Aldemir’s dissertation, the idea that experiences, beliefs, and knowledge affect
how pre-service teachers approach their students, the parents, and their teaching is
studied. Special focus was given to how these beliefs were formed. Beliefs and where
they come from are crucial because they can affect teacher’s decision-making and
classroom pedagogy. Pre-service teachers also have the opportunity to grow and
factor in new information as they learn how to teach. In the end, researchers found
that a relationship between the factors did in fact exist. They also found that
memories and experiences from their own childhood education experience impacted
the pre-service teachers’ beliefs regarding their students, parents, and pedagogies.
